ORTHOPEDICS

ORTHOPEDICS

Orthopedics is a medical specialty focused on the diagnosis, treatment, and rehabilitation of disorders and injuries of the musculoskeletal system. Orthopedic surgeons are medical doctors who specialize in the prevention and management of conditions affecting bones, joints, muscles, ligaments, tendons, and nerves. They treat a wide range of orthopedic conditions, including fractures, arthritis, sports injuries, spinal disorders, and congenital deformities. Orthopedic care includes both surgical interventions, such as joint replacement surgeries and fracture repair, as well as non-surgical treatments like physical therapy and medications. Orthopedic specialists work closely with patients to restore mobility, alleviate pain, and improve quality of life through personalized treatment plans.
